I'm kicking off the New Year with an I Heart Indie Books Reading Challenge. This is an easy low-key challenge to help introduce new readers to indie books and encourage current indie readers to find some new favorites.
» All genres welcome
» Runs the entire year
» Jump in at any time
» Must be self-published titles or small indie press
» Authors are welcome and encouraged to participate in the challenge because you're a reader too!
The challenge goals for the year are:
Level 1
- 1-6 books - Bronze
- 7-12 books - Silver
- 13-18 books - Gold
- 19-24 books - Platinum
- 25-30 books - Diamond
Level 2
- 31-36 books - Bronze Elite
- 37-42 books - Silver Elite
- 43-48 books - Gold Elite
- 49-54 books - Platinum Elite
- 55+ books - Diamond Elite
» There are two levels so you can choose the one that fits your reading style and speed.
» This challenge can easily overlap other challenges you are doing.
» Not sure which level to shoot for? Treat it like a step-up challenge. Just start at the bottom then when you reach the end of one level just "step-up" to the next level. See how many steps you can take by the end of the year.
Need more of a challenge? Try these OPTIONAL add-ons that can be applied at any level:
- Only count unique authors (in other words an author can only be counted once even if you read more than one of their books)
- Do not overlap with any other challenges
- Do a modified A-Z on author names - each last name must begin with a different letter of the alphabet. If you get through all the letters just start over again!
